Subject: Quickstore 4.2 — bloom filter now fronts the KV layer

Plugin authors: starting with this release, Quickstore places a bloom filter ahead of the key-value store. Negative lookups return faster; false positives fall through safely. No API changes are required on your side. Verify your plugin against the staging build referenced below.

session token of fahif-tadup = htk3_9c7

**Q: Where is the recovery material referenced in the Murkwater stale-cache postmortem?**

A: During the incident, the Pellgrove CDN served receipts from an expired cache layer for roughly forty minutes. The postmortem action items require the release manager to verify cache-bust headers before each cut, and to hold the emergency invalidation credentials. Those credentials live in the sealed Tindlemoor vault, and unlocking it requires the recovery passphrase, which is recorded immediately below for release-manager use only.

recovery phrase for fawif-tajeg: norael-aldmir-casir-brivan-ulaion

## First-Day Checklist — Shared Lab Access

- Contractors: our Fabrication Lab on Level 2 is shared with the Korvette Systems team next door, so don't move anything on the blue benches — that's their kit. Sign the lab log at the door, grab safety glasses from the rack, and keep the roller shutter closed after 18:00. To get through the lab's side entrance, punch in the visitor code below.

turnstile pass: bdg-QZV-3

TURN-208: Gatevale turnstile counters at the Merrow Field pilot double-count when a rotation reverses mid-cycle. Attendance totals drift roughly 2% high per event. The debounce window fix is implemented, reviewed by Ilsa, and soak-tested across two simulated match days without drift. Ready for your cut; the candidate build is identified below.

trace token, tagag-tafog: htk6_5ed18c